Overview: The document details specifications and configurations for various creel systems used in yarn processing, designed to accommodate different yarn package sizes and enhance work efficiency. It outlines several types of creel systems, each with unique features and applications.
Modular Creel Systems: These systems are constructed with steel profiles for flexibility in yarn package dimensions. They offer customizable vertical and horizontal spacing, fast threading synthetic ceramic yarn guides, and integrated electronic stop motion systems. Package holders can be fixed or movable, suitable for any yarn package type.
Swivelling Frame Creel: This system allows continuous operation by loading reserve packages while one side is working. It features an adjustable distance between the yarn package and tensioner for optimal ballooning effect and requires lateral corridors for package loading.
Jacquard Creel: A fixed creel system structured in two levels for space efficiency, suitable for Raschel machinery. It provides easy access to the second level and maintains a fixed distance from the yarn package to the tensioner, equipped with tensioner model T-2000.
Magazine Jacquard Creel: Similar to the Jacquard Creel but includes a reserve system for continuous warping. It is designed for space-saving with two levels and allows for knotting the final yarn end to the reserve package.
V Creel: A high-performance V-shaped creel for high warping speeds, suitable for spun yarns at low tension levels. It does not require lateral corridors for package loading and includes an electronic control panel for monitoring yarn usage and breakage indicators.
Tensioners: Universal tensioners are adjustable directly on the machine, suitable for low draw-off speeds and various yarn types. They are equipped with tensioning plates and adjustable tension via an upper spring.

DOUBLE-SIDED FIXED CREEL Fixed distance from yarn package to tensioner. Lateral corridors are required for package loading (outside loading). Thread draw-off outside. Steel modular creel system. Designed for any yarn package size offering the best work efficiency. Vertical and horizontal pitch according customer specifications. End quantity, levels and rows, according customer specifications and available space. Integrated electronic stop motion system offering immediate response. Fast threading synthetic ceramic yarn guides, placed on each creel module. Fixed or movable package holders suitable...

MOVING TENSIONER FRAMES CREEL Adjustable distance from yarn package to tensioner. Positioning both for optimal ballooning. No lateral corridors are required for package loading (outside frame position for package loading). Thread draw-off outside or inside. Steel modular creel system. Designed for any yarn package size offering the best work efficiency. Vertical and horizontal pitch according customer specifications. End quantity, levels and rows, according customer specifications and available space. Integrated electronic stop motion system offering immediate response. Fast threading synthetic...

MAGAZINE CREEL Transfer capability for continuous warping and minimum waste, by knotting final yarn end of the running package to the beginning of the reserve one. Fixed distance from yarn package to tensioner. Lateral and central corridors are required for package loading and knotting. Thread draw-off outside (Inward loading / Outward knotting). Thread draw-off inside (Outward loading / Inward knotting). Steel modular creel system. Designed for any yarn package size offering the best work efficiency. Vertical and horizontal pitch according customer specifications. End quantity, levels and rows,...

TRUCK CREEL Interchangeable double-sided yarn package trucks on wheels, for fast reserve package loading. Using moving tensioner frames. Adjustable distance from yarn package to tensioner. Positioning both for optimal ballooning. Change of yarn packages is made outside the creel, on reserve trucks, being not necessary lateral corridors for package loading. Thread draw-off outside. Steel modular creel system. Designed for any yarn package size offering the best work efficiency. Vertical and horizontal pitch according customer specifications. End quantity, levels and rows, according customer specifications...

Creel system to warp flat polypropylene yarns (raffia). Individual spindle per bobbin or spool, supplied with rotation system (Deroule system) Lateral corridors are required for package loading (outside loading). Thread draw-off front part. Steel modular creel system. Designed for predetermined yarn package size. Vertical and horizontal pitch according customer specifications (F7). Vertical and horizontal pitch of 230 mm (F7D). End quantity, levels and rows, according customer specifications and available space. No electronic stop motion system is required. (Can be optionally supplied). Fast...

SWIVELLING FRAME CREEL TENSIONER / TENSOR / TENDEUR While one side working, at the other side reserve package loading for minimum downtime, aligning swivelling frames in the run position again. Using moving tensioner frames. Adjustable distance from yarn package to tensioner. Positioning both for optimal ballooning. Lateral corridors are required for package loading (outside reserve loading). Thread draw-off inside. Steel modular creel system. Designed for any yarn package size offering the best work efficiency. JACQUARD CREEL Fixed creel system, structured in two levels for space saving. Suitable for raschel machinery feeding. Easy access to second level platform. Fixed distance from yarn package to tensioner. Lateral corridors on two levels are required for package loading (outside loading). Thread draw-off inside. Steel modular creel system. Designed for any yarn package size offering the best work efficiency. Vertical and horizontal pitch according customer specifications. End quantity, levels and rows, according customer specifications and available space. Fast threading synthetic ceramic yarn guides,...
